New England News and Notes SUFFOLK DOWNS Boston Mass June 8 Rough Pass and Hop Skip are the latest to make the growing stewards list at the Downs Both must be okayed before their further entries will be accepted Topee and Snarleyow have been removed from the track veterinarians list and their entry may now be accepted Trainer W G Douglass has sent Sauri derstown to the Norfojk Hunt Club to make room for others coming tojoin the Allen T Simmons string Cinesar was included in the halfdozen thoroughbreds that J E Packer shipped Sunday to Montreal for various owners J J Johnson trainer of the H H Haag string has room for several other horses in the car he is shipping to Washington Park later in the week Joe Binstock returned from Montreal and plans sending another draft of platers to that point for a campaign on the Quebec circuit H G Bedwell has sent Creepy Mouse and Happy Dart to the farm at Laurel Md to be turned out outP P Mecklenburg disposed of the plater Burgoo Prince to V L Creal at private sale Creal is getting together a string to take to Montreal Allen T Simmons who has a string cam ¬ paigning at Suffolk Downs in charge of trainer W G Douglass is expected at the Boston course some time this week weekWabaunsee Wabaunsee has been sold at private terms to A Marano and will be shipped to Charles Town for a West Virginia cam ¬ paign Joe Binstock purchased Valdina Flare and Quiz Baby and shipped them to Can ¬ ada Jockey Johnny Breen has been engaged to ride J H Louchheims First Son in Sat ¬ urdays Plymouth Rock Handicap at six furlongs Ben Luchka registered Macks Arrow and Belmar Bess They were turned out follow ¬ ing the close of Narragansett and picked up for Suffolk Downs racing racingThe The victory of Woodford Lad in last Sat ¬ urdays Commonwealth Handicap marked the first stakes victory for the stable of A F Plock Plock whose home is at Miami Beach is visiting New England for the first time Joe Dattilo arrived on the local scene Tuesday and swung into action immediate ¬ ly He was astride Jessie Gladys in the first Ardenell in the second and Tilting in the fifth Copy for the fourth issue of the Suffolk Downs condition books is in the hands of the printer and will be available for distri ¬ bution within the next few days daysTrainer Trainer F J Baker informed Harvey Ellson who is handling the division of the W W Crenshaw string in New England that Zaca Rosa was enroute from New YorkSuffolk Downs DownsJockey Jockey Charley Wahler injured in a spill with Wishing last week paid a visit to Suf ¬ folk Downs but plans leaving for California on a business trip before returning to the saddle
